Introducción a HTML: Fundamentos y Usos Principales
HTML, siglas de HyperText Markup Language, es un lenguaje de marcado crucial para la creación de páginas web. A menudo considerado el esqueleto de internet, HTML establece la estructura básica de un sitio web mediante el uso de elementos y etiquetas que definen cada sección y contenido de una página.
Fundamentos de HTML
Los documentos HTML están compuestos por una serie de elementos, identificados por etiquetas como <h1>
para títulos o <p>
para párrafos. Estos elementos se combinan para estructurar visualmente el contenido. Un archivo HTML básico comienza con una declaración <!DOCTYPE html>
que le indica al navegador la versión de HTML utilizada. Las etiquetas esenciales incluyen <html>
, <head>
, y <body>
, que organizan el contenido en diferentes secciones.
Usos Principales de HTML
HTML es fundamental para la creación de sitios web estáticos donde la información no requiere actualizaciones frecuentes. Además, es ampliamente utilizado para estructurar contenidos en plataformas como blogs o páginas de noticias. Con la integración de CSS y JavaScript, HTML permite el diseño complejo y la interacción dinámica, haciendo posible la creación de experiencias web ricas y atractivas.
- Organización del contenido mediante listas y tablas.
- Incrustación de imágenes, vídeos y otros medios.
- Creación de enlaces de navegación entre diferentes páginas web.
¿Qué es CSS? Comprendiendo su Rol en el Diseño Web
El Cascading Style Sheets (CSS) es un lenguaje de diseño que se utiliza para describir la presentación de un documento escrito en HTML o XML. Su principal función es separar el contenido del documento de su presentación visual. Esto no solo permite una mayor flexibilidad en el diseño, sino que también mejora la accesibilidad del sitio web.
CSS permite a los diseñadores y desarrolladores controlar el estilo de múltiples páginas al mismo tiempo, facilitando la coherencia visual y reduciendo el tiempo de trabajo. A través de CSS, se puede manejar desde la estructura del diseño como el formato de texto, hasta aspectos más complejos como animaciones y transiciones. Estos estilos pueden aplicarse de manera general o tener especificaciones únicas para diferentes dispositivos, haciendo que el sitio web sea más responsivo.
Importancia de CSS en la Experiencia del Usuario
En el mundo actual del diseño web, la experiencia del usuario es una prioridad clave. CSS juega un rol vital en este aspecto al permitir que las páginas web sean visualmente atractivas y fáciles de navegar. Un buen uso de CSS puede hacer que un sitio web destaque, mejorando no solo su apariencia, sino también su funcionalidad.
Cómo HTML y CSS Trabajan Juntos para Crear Páginas Web
HTML y CSS son las piedras angulares del desarrollo web. HTML, que significa Hypertext Markup Language, se encarga de estructurar el contenido de la web. Utiliza etiquetas para definir elementos como encabezados, párrafos, listas, enlaces e imágenes, proporcionando así un marco básico para las páginas web.
Por otro lado, CSS, o Cascading Style Sheets, se ocupa de presentar y dar estilo al contenido estructurado por HTML. CSS permite aplicar colores, fuentes, márgenes, y diseños a las páginas, asegurando que sean visualmente atractivas y fáciles de usar. Gracias a CSS, los desarrolladores pueden transformar una estructura básica de HTML en una interfaz elegante y dinámica.
Interacción entre HTML y CSS
La relación entre HTML y CSS es fundamental para el diseño web. Mientras que HTML define la estructura, CSS controla la apariencia del contenido. Esta interacción se logra a través de la vinculación de hojas de estilo CSS con documentos HTML. Dichas hojas de estilo pueden estar incrustadas directamente en el documento HTML o enlazadas externamente, permitiendo una mayor flexibilidad y control sobre la presentación visual.
Selectors de CSS se utilizan para aplicar estilos a elementos HTML específicos. Por ejemplo, un selector puede dirigirse a todos los párrafos de una página, o quizás solo a aquellos con una clase particular, y aplicarles cambios de estilo como tamaño de fuente o color de texto. Esta colaboración entre HTML y CSS es lo que permite a los diseñadores web crear páginas que no solo funcionan correctamente, sino que también son estéticamente agradables.
Principales Diferencias entre HTML y CSS
HTML (HyperText Markup Language) y CSS (Cascading Style Sheets) son dos tecnologías esenciales para la creación y diseño de páginas web, pero desempeñan roles distintos. HTML es el encargado de proporcionar la estructura y el contenido de una página, utilizando etiquetas que definen elementos como encabezados, párrafos, imágenes y enlaces. En contraste, CSS se utiliza para controlar la presentación visual de estos elementos, incluyendo aspectos como colores, fuentes, y disposición de las cajas en la página.
Función y Propósito
HTML actúa como el esqueleto de la página web, permitiendo a los desarrolladores organizar y estructurar contenido de manera lógica. Por su parte, CSS se enfoca en el estético de la web, proporcionando numerosas herramientas para mejorar y personalizar la apariencia del contenido estructurado por HTML. Por ejemplo, a través de CSS es posible modificar el estilo de texto, añadir animaciones y manejar el diseño para que sea adaptable a diferentes tamaños de pantalla.
Sintaxis y Aplicación
Otra diferencia significativa entre HTML y CSS es su sintaxis y modo de aplicación. HTML utiliza una estructura basada en etiquetas encapsuladas dentro de los signos ‘menos que’ y ‘mayor que’, mientras que CSS opera con selectores y declaraciones entre llaves. Además, HTML se encuentra embebido directamente en el documento web, mientras que CSS puede integrarse ya sea en el mismo documento HTML o externamente mediante archivos .css vinculados. Esta separación de estilo y contenido permite una mayor flexibilidad y facilidad para realizar cambios en el diseño sin alterar la estructura básica.
Independencia y Interdependencia
Es crucial entender que, aunque HTML y CSS son tecnologías independientes, funcionan en conjunto para crear experiencias web óptimas. HTML por sí solo puede visualizarse sin estilos, pero CSS necesita de HTML para aplicar sus diseños. Esta interdependencia permite que desarrolladores y diseñadores trabajen sinérgicamente, garantizando sitios web funcionales y visualmente atractivos.
Beneficios de Aprender HTML y CSS para tu Carrera Profesional
El conocimiento de HTML y CSS abre múltiples puertas en el ámbito profesional, especialmente si buscas vincularte al mundo digital. Comprender estas tecnologías fundamentales no solo te permitirá crear y diseñar páginas web atractivas, sino que también mejorará tu capacidad para comunicarte efectivamente con equipos de desarrollo y diseño.
Desarrollo de Competencias Técnicas
Al dominar HTML y CSS, adquieres habilidades técnicas que son muy valoradas en la industria actual. Incluso si tu rol no es directamente técnico, poseer un entendimiento básico de la estructura y el diseño web te hará destacar y facilitará la colaboración con desarrolladores y diseñadores.
Incremento de Oportunidades Laborales
Aprender HTML y CSS también puede aumentar significativamente tus oportunidades de empleo. Muchas empresas buscan candidatos con habilidades en estas áreas debido a la naturaleza omnipresente de la tecnología web. Ya sea en marketing, gestión de proyectos o desarrollo web, el conocimiento de estas herramientas es un complemento valioso para cualquier currículum.
Capacidad para Crear y Personalizar Proyectos
Entender HTML y CSS te brinda la capacidad de crear y personalizar tus propios proyectos web. Este control creativo no solo resulta en productos finales más personalizados, sino que también permite a los profesionales de otras áreas como diseñadores gráficos o escritores de contenido, presentar sus trabajos en una plataforma digital de manera efectiva.